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Как лучше организовать хранение данных?
|
|||
|---|---|---|---|
|
#18+
Извините если что не так :) Необходимо организовать хранение 100000 файлов в формате .doc в БД клиент пишется на java БД - postgresql on linux клиенты - windows и mac os x Собственно вопрос - как лучше организовать хранение вордовского документа в БД, чтобы его можно было просматривать в приложении java без существенных искажений? Сп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2004, 10:46 |
|
||
|
Как лучше организовать хранение данных?
|
|||
|---|---|---|---|
|
#18+
В моей системе файл хранится в виде стрима. Файл любого типа. Для простоты, в таблице два поля, текстовое для наименования файла и Blob для содержимого. Специальный метод создает на диске новый файл, с именем из текстового поля, заполняет его данными из Blob, сохраняет и открывает стандартным методом операционки. Измененный файл можно сохранить обратно в базу. Система Delphi7/MSSQL2000 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.05.2004, 22:53 |
|
||
|
Как лучше организовать хранение данных?
|
|||
|---|---|---|---|
|
#18+
Спасибо. Хотел спросить быстро ли все работает, у нас одновременных запросов к базе около 20. И все на чтение/ввод. Мне критично чтобы это все быстро открывалось при просмотре результатов выборки + еще нужен встроенный поиск по содержимому документа. Я лично склоняюсь к тому, чтобы переконвертировать все файлы .doc в .xml и сделать поле с .xhtml для просмотра. Может кто-то что-нибудь похожее уже делал? Если есть мысли, буду рад услышать. Заранее сп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.05.2004, 01:39 |
|
||
|
Как лучше организовать хранение данных?
|
|||
|---|---|---|---|
|
#18+
Я делаю как Old Nick, только еще организую кэширование. В БД для файла хранится еще и последняя дата его записи в БД. Сначала я считываю метаданные по файлу, смотрю, что у меня в файловом кэше. Если такого файла там нет или он устаревший, скачиваю само тело из БД и устанавливаю в созданном файле дату тика в тику как в базе.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.05.2004, 08:49 |
|
||
|
|

start [/forum/topic.php?fid=32&gotonew=1&tid=1546449]: |
0ms |
get settings: |
10ms |
get forum list: |
18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
149ms |
get topic data: |
8ms |
get first new msg: |
5ms |
get forum data: |
2ms |
get page messages: |
48ms |
get tp. blocked users: |
2ms |
| others: | 233ms |
| total: | 481ms |

| 0 / 0 |
